Buy
Rent
Landlords
Sell
Discover
Contact
St Marys Terrace, Little Venice, W2
4 Beds
3 Baths
2,529 sq.ft
£2,308 pw
St Peters Place, W9, Maida Vale, W9
2 Baths
1,490 sq.ft
£1,108 pw